También en el espacio de la biblioteca, la versión candidata incluye los tipos ZLibCompressionOptions y BrotliCompressionOptions para establecer el nivel de compresión específico del algoritmo y la estrategia de compresión para los usuarios que necesitan configuraciones más precisas que las que admite CompressionLevel existente. Las nuevas opciones de compresión están diseñadas para permitir la expansión de las opciones en el futuro. En otro cambio de la biblioteca, los eventos LogLevel.Trace registrados por HttpClientFactory ya no incluyen valores de encabezado de forma predeterminada. Para .NET MAUI en .NET 9, el objetivo es mejorar la calidad del producto, incluida la expansión de la cobertura de pruebas, las pruebas de escenarios de extremo a extremo y la corrección de errores. Estas mejoras se enfatizaron en las siete versiones preliminares de .NET 9. La extensión VS Code ahora incluye mejoras en HorizontalTextAlignment.justify para que alinee horizontalmente el texto en las etiquetas. Para ASP.NET Core, el boletín RC señala que la versión preliminar 6, del 15 de julio, agregó compatibilidad inicial con el seguimiento distribuido de SignalR. RC1 mejora el rastreo de señales con el cliente SignalR que tiene una ActivitySource llamada Microsoft.AspNetCore.SignalR.Client. Las invocaciones de hub ahora crean un intervalo de cliente. Además, las invocaciones de hub del cliente al servidor ahora admiten la propagación del contexto. La propagación del contexto de rastreo permite un verdadero rastreo distribuido, afirmó Microsoft. Ahora es posible ver el flujo de invocaciones desde el cliente al servidor y viceversa.